Toxins in the characterization of potassium channels.

N A Castle, D G Haylett, D H Jenkinson.   

Abstract

Several recently characterized toxins (apamin, charybdotoxin, dendrotoxin and noxiustoxin) are proving invaluable for establishing what kinds of potassium channel are expressed in neurones, and what the roles of the channels might be.
